A family has been left terrified after an attempted car jacking in Herefordshire late yesterday evening.

At 11.30pm there was an attempted car jacking on on a family in Herefordshire. The family that was targeted aren’t from Hereford but the M50 was closed so they had to reroute to get in to Wales.

The road that they travelled along was the A4103 towards the A465 where they travelled along Folly Lane and past ‘The Cock Tupsley’.

A member of the family said the following:

“I implore anyone who has CCTV or knows of anyone along the A4103 who may have CCTV to PLEASE check it. West Mercia Police were informed immediately but they quickly made off. There were 3 vehicles; a maroon/red hatchback, a motorbike and a large dark coloured van that looked like a big horse truck.

“I can assume they had the motorbike in the large van when they made off after blocking the road to try and stop us. Luckily with quick thinking we managed to get away but someone elderly or travelling alone may not be so lucky! They had followed us from near the Red Lion pub at a junction, and attempted to stop us just after Yarkhill. Please contact police if anyone has any information as we suspect this is likely to happen in the same area. We had our child in our car and they obviously have no consideration that someone vulnerable could have been in the car.”

Anyone with any information is asked to contact West Mercia Police on 101 using reference – 833_i_29072020.
